What type of extraction do you use and why?

- This process is very simple to understand. The two primary components of CO2 extraction are temperature and pressure. CO2, a molecule that every person exhales when they breathe, is highly pressurized which turns it into a liquid. It is kept cool to maintain liquid form).

- Since cannabinoids are oil in their active form, they are non-polar. At high pressures, the non-polar CO2 is ran through the plant materials and is able to extract the constituents away from the raw plant turning it into a highly concentrated solution.

- After the solution has accrued all of these components, mainly CBD, the solution is then pumped from an area of high pressure to low pressure while simultaneously being heated.

- This heating allows the CO2 to convert back to a gas and evaporate. At the same time, this lower pressure decreases the solubility of CO2 and the oils begin to ‘precipitate’ out.
